Angelica acutiloba Kitagawa (scientific name: Touki) is a perennial herb in the Umbelliferae family, native to Japan. The roots are used as a herbal medicine called "Touki" and as an ingredient in traditional Chinese medicine. The leaves have a distinctive celery-like aftertaste, and in Europe they are known as "Angel Herb" after their scientific name.Gin is a spirit (distilled alcoholic beverage) that originated in Europe, and is a fragrant drink that is blended with various botanicals (fragrant and medicinal herbs) including juniper berries as its core ingredient. "Angel's Gin" uses angelica leaves from Rikubetsu Town, Tokachi, Hokkaido, and was developed in cooperation with "Shakotan Spirit" in Shakotan Town, Hokkaido. A total of 11 botanicals are blended as shown below.
The moment you sip, you'll sense the elegance of juniper berries, followed by a gradual aroma of refreshing, spicy botanicals. Finally, the distinctive character of angelica leaf emerges, enveloping the entire flavor, allowing you to enjoy the richness and layering of the aroma. Angelica leaf pairs well with meat, fish, and tomato-based dishes, making it a great accompaniment to meals.
